Warning Signs You Need Ceiling Water Extraction
Catching these signs early can save you money and prevent bigger problems. Don’t ignore the following warning signs: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, unpleasant odors can show mold growth or water damage. If you notice persistent musty smells, investigate the source and act quickly to prevent further damage.
Water Stains on Your Ceiling
Water stains can be a sign of a leaky roof or water damage. If you notice water stains, check for leaks and address the issue quickly.
Warped or Buckled Ceiling Tiles
Warped or buckled ceiling tiles can show water damage or structural issues. If you notice this, investigate the cause and seek professional help.
Unexplained Mold Growth
Mold growth can be a sign of water damage or poor ventilation. If you notice mold growth, address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.
Increased Energy Bills
Increased energy bills can show water damage or poor insulation. If you notice a spike in energy bills, investigate the cause and address the issue quickly.
Visible Water Leaks
Visible water leaks can be a sign of a serious issue. If you notice water leaks, act quickly to prevent further damage.
Ceiling Water Extraction v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small water leak with minimal damage | Yes | No | You can likely handle the issue on your own with a wet/dry vacuum and some towels. |
| Large water leak with extensive damage | No | Yes | Professional help is needed to prevent further damage and ensure the area is properly dried and treated. |
| Water damage with mold growth | No | Yes | Professional help is needed to safely remove mold and prevent further growth. |
| Unknown source of water leak | No | Yes | Professional help is needed to identify and repair the source of the leak. |
| Highly contaminated water | No | Yes | Professional help is needed to safely handle and dispose of contaminated water. |

Q: Is ceiling water extraction covered by insurance?
A: In most cases, ceiling water extraction is covered by insurance. But, the specifics depend on your policy and the circumstances of the damage. Check your policy and contact your insurance provider to find out what’s covered.
Q: How do I prevent ceiling water damage in the future?
A: To prevent ceiling water damage, regularly inspect your roof check for leaks and maintain your gutters. Also, consider installing a sump pump or backup power source to ensure you’re prepared in case of an emergency. Stay proactive and prevent future problems.
